What is one of the principles of Universal Protocol? - ANSWER - Universal Protocol involves consistently implementing a standardized policy. Who is responsible for marking the operative or invasive procedure site? - ANSWER - The site is marked by an LIP who is ultimately accountable will be present for the operative or invasive procedure. To comply with Universal Protocol in this particular situation, what should be done? - ANSWER - Prepare the patient for an immediate operative or invasive procedure per the practitioner's direction. A patient is brought to the OR for a bilateral knee replacement operation. What should the unscrubbed perioperative team member do? - ANSWER - Insist the perioperative team member refer to the checklist. During the preprocedure verification the unscrubbed perioperative team member notices that the operative procedure consent and the scheduled operative procedure do not match. What should the unscrubbed perioperative team member do next? - ANSWER - Alert the practitioner immediately.
